Isomorphic WebSockets in Node, Bun, Deno and Cloudflare Workers
Use websockets with the node streams API. Works in browser and node
It's react's useEffect hook, except using deep comparison on the inputs, not reference equality
Create components whose prop changes map to a global side effect
An HTTP(s) proxy `http.Agent` implementation for HTTPS
Ponyfill of the experimental `React.useEffectEvent` hook
Create components whose prop changes map to a global side effect
A React hook that uses useEffect() on the server and useLayoutEffect() in the browser
Durable workflows for Effect
Unified interfaces for common platform-specific services
Functional programming in TypeScript
Simple, EventEmitter API for WebSockets (browser)
Cast aria-hidden to everything, except...
Message based Two-way remote procedure call
Use the same WebSocket client code in a browser or Node.js for isomorphic apps
Experimental modules for the Effect ecosystem
A better WebSocket that Just Works™
basic websocket support for fastify
An easy to use, extensible pretty-printer for rendering documents for the terminal
ESLint rule to warn against unnecessary React useEffect hooks.
WebRTC For Node.js and Electron. libdatachannel node bindings.
OpenTelemetry integration for Effect
A set of helpers for testing Effects with vitest
Coherent, zero-dependency, lazy, simple, GraphQL over WebSocket Protocol compliant server and client